In order to study the smoke toxicity characteristics of expandable fireproof coatings during fires,a NBS smoke density test box was used to conduct laboratory scale fire simulation tests on 6 types of expandable fireproof coatings.FTIR analysis system was used to sample and analyze 8 types of gases,and the conventional toxicity index(CITG)was used to quantitatively evaluate the toxicity of flue gas.The results showed that the flue gas produced by the expandable fireproof coating contained CO2,CO,NOx and HCN gases.The toxicity of epoxy resin based expandable fireproof coatings was much greater than that of other resin based coatings.The NOx gas mass concentration at 4 min and 8 min was 108.43 mg·m-3 and 136.47 mg·m-3,respectively,which were higher than the reference concentration of 38 mg·m-3,and the CITG value reached 0.377 at 8 min.FITR gas analysis method can achieve online,multi-component gas rapid analysis,but there is significant interference and error in gas content near the detection limit.
